The RNA lariat debranching enzyme, Dbr1, is a metallophosphoesterase that cleaves 2'-5' phosphodiester bonds within intronic lariats. Previous reports have indicated that Dbr1 enzymatic activity is supported by diverse metal ions including Ni(2+) , Mn(2+) , Mg(2+) , Fe(2+) , and Zn(2+) . While in initial structures of the Entamoeba histolytica Dbr1 only one of the two catalytic metal-binding sites were observed to be occupied (with a Mn(2+) ion), recent structures determined a Zn(2+) /Fe(2+) heterobinucleation. We solved a high-resolution X-ray crystal structure (1.8 A) of the E. histolytica Dbr1 and determined a Zn(2+) /Mn(2+) occupancy. ICP-AES corroborate this finding, and in vitro debranching assays with fluorescently labeled branched substrates confirm activity.
